Precision Medicine and Personalized Care AI algorithms can process vast amounts of patient data, including genetic information, medical history, and lifestyle factors, to create highly personalized profiles. This enables clinicians to tailor treatments to the specific needs of each patient, maximizing efficacy while minimizing side effects. Precision medicine approaches powered by AI hold promise for managing complex conditions such as cancer and diabetes. Early Disease Detection and Diagnosis AI-driven systems can analyze medical images, such as X-rays and MRI scans, with remarkable accuracy. This allows for the early detection and diagnosis of diseases that may otherwise go unnoticed. AI-empowered algorithms can also identify patterns in electronic health records and predict the likelihood of developing certain conditions, enabling preventive interventions. Drug Discovery and Development AI has revolutionized drug discovery by accelerating the process and improving success rates. AI algorithms can screen vast chemical libraries, simulate molecular interactions, and predict potential drug candidates. This has led to the development of new drugs with enhanced efficacy and reduced side effects, paving the way for more effective treatments. Clinical Decision Support AI systems can provide real-time clinical decision support to healthcare professionals. By analyzing patient data and comparing it to evidence-based guidelines, AI algorithms can suggest optimal treatment plans and alert clinicians to potential risks or complications. This enhances diagnostic accuracy, streamlines treatment recommendations, and improves patient safety. Remote Patient Monitoring and Telehealth AI-powered wearable devices and remote monitoring platforms enable healthcare providers to track patient health status in real-time. This facilitates early detection of health issues, proactive interventions, and improved communication between patients and their caregivers. Telehealth services powered by AI enhance accessibility to healthcare, particularly for patients in remote or underserved areas.
